For those Windows users who don’t understand why one cares about a z release (xx.yy.zz), you have to remember that OS X is perpetually stuck at version 10, thus, 10.y releases are our new "versions" (think of 10.4 as version 14), and 10.y.z releases are one step below a brand new version. In Windows land, they would be best though of as large service packs. Except that we get about 9 service packs a year, and a new OS version every 18 months. Details, details…
